About Richard

I offer a private dance space! Weddings: I’ve spent 5 years specializing in first dances, working with 80+ couples a year to craft something that feels personal and looks great on the floor. Wedding couples are my specialty—and my favorite. Whatever your timeline, song, or goal, I’ll give you an unforgettable experience and the tools to keep dancing together for life. Social Dancing: I've worked at a number of Bay Area studios in the past that were focused on Partner Dance experiences. I will help you navigate dance social events, finding a partner, etc.

Social Dance Work Flow: Very focused on the flow and the partnering. I want the dancing to serve your goals. I understand that for most, the goal is to have fun, be musical, and comfortable dancing in a variety of social settings. I want to give you the tools to be excited to go out there and dance.

Wedding Work Flow: On the first lesson we start with basics tailored to your song, connect them to its mood and energy, then layer in solid partnering skills. My goal by the end of the first lesson is to have the leader comfortable with leading their partner through the basic steps. The next lessons will focus on creating a plan/choreography for the couple. A "entrance" making a meaningful impact at the beginning of your dance. A "middle section" that is your basic moves and making use of moments in the music create some kind of highlight. Finally a "grand finish"—a dip, lift, or a signature pose that fits you.

 My Teaching Style/Philosophy/Goal:
1. Style is hands-on, with precise instruction and clear feedback.
2. Philosophy is simple: "is this cool?" and "is this useful?" I won’t teach generic steps that don’t serve your goals.
3. Goal: Chemistry and togetherness are top priorities. Whether we build full choreography or keep it loose/improvised, my aim is that you dance as yourselves—with confidence. Who I work with: I work with absolute beginners and dancers of all levels. I will assess your level on the lesson and work with you on a dance that is at your level or just above. I want you to surpass your own expectations for yourself. I love to work with everyone no matter your genders or orientations. I am a cis-gendered AMAB and I curate a space inclusive to folx of all walks of life.

Additional help I provide:
 - I can provide music editing so your song is the perfect length for a small charge of $55
 - Choosing your Song: If you're stuck between choices I can rate/compare your song(s) based on their danceability and wow factor. I can describe to you the style of movement and the atmosphere it will create.
 - At the end of your lesson I can film practice videos for you to take home with you to reference. My dancing skillset: I'm skilled as a ballroom and Latin dancer. Besides wedding dancing, I teach Waltz, Quicksteps, Foxtrot, Tango, Cha Cha, Rumba, Samba, Jive, Salsa, Swing and more.
